Plasma sterilizer: The Plasma sterilizer segment represents the pinnacle of modern low temperature infection control technology utilized extensively throughout advanced healthcare facilities. These sophisticated systems utilize radio frequency or microwave energy to excite hydrogen peroxide gas into a highly reactive state creating a powerful biocidal environment. This gentle yet highly effective process ensures the safe reprocessing of delicate endoscopes camera systems and sensitive electronic surgical tools that would otherwise sustain catastrophic damage in traditional steam environments. Hospital administrators heavily favor this technology because it leaves absolutely no toxic residue completely eliminating the need for lengthy aeration periods. The rapid cycle completion allows sterile processing departments to return critical inventory to operating rooms swiftly maximizing overall procedural efficiency. Pulsating vacuum sterilizer: The Pulsating vacuum sterilizer segment remains an absolutely fundamental component of central sterile services departments serving as the primary workhorse for standard moisture resistant medical equipment. These robust systems utilize a sophisticated sequence of vacuum phases to aggressively remove ambient air from the chamber ensuring optimal steam penetration into dense surgical packs and porous materials. The dynamic air removal process guarantees that high temperature steam reaches every internal surface of complex instruments effectively destroying all resistant microbial life forms and bacterial spores. Healthcare facilities rely on these high capacity units to process the vast majority of standard surgical stainless steel tools textiles and durable surgical instruments required for daily hospital operations. Operational metrics indicate these powerful systems routinely achieve processing temperatures of 134 degrees Celsius to guarantee total sterilization.
